Wagering multipliers at Lets Lucky might feel like your worst enemy when it comes to the real cash you pocket from bonuses. They often multiply the bonus amount 30x or more, which means a $100 bonus could demand $3,000 in bets before you see a cent. This shrinks your actual profit and demands patience and discipline.
